Breaking News: Greg Hardy took five seconds out of his life to not be a scumbag.
The troubled Cowboys defensive end was asked to sign a Panthers helmet at a Gameday Sports Tours promotion Monday night, but he refused. The Panthers opted not to re-sign Hardy after his domestic violence incident a year ago.
Rather than sign the helmet, Hardy chose to make up for it by giving an autographed $100 bill to the fan.
